AND INVESTMENT SOCIETY (Permanent). Directors: Messrs. Richard Cock (chairman), A. Shuttleworth. AA : . L. Newman, Newton King, A. Goldwater, T. K. Skinner and Colonel Ellis. BUY YOUR OWN HOME. The Society lends money on Freehold or approved Leasehold Lands. The borrower may select his own architect, plans and builder. The Society pays cost of preparing and registering all mortgages of £IOO or over. All profits divided equally amongst borrowers and investors. The Society is purely co-operative. < Based on the calculation of the profits made during the last few years, the time required to repay a loan is seven years. For example: A member borrowing £IOO (five shares at £2O each), would have paid-in monthly instalments of £1 11s 8d in seven years £133 0 0 From which, deducting the amount of tho loan 100 0 0 Would leave as paid for interest tho balance £33 0 0 The Society has a RESERVE FUND of over £2OOO, Write for prospectus and particulars.
